Dad Is Dead

So what? No more new toys for you No more bread at breakfast No more noisy shoes on Christmas And no more having more Did i kill dad? No! Why then the corporal punishments? Because dad lost the job Dad lost the breath Dad lost the plan Dad lost you Dad is no more Why punish me not the job? Dad got money from there Can i go and get it? Not now but one day you will What about you? I will go but i have to first make you know That i am not Dad because he took off Now he is sleeping We have to spend less Work a lot Play less Why don't you awake him? He is dead! What does that mean? It means close your eyes Stop breathing Sleep in a big box People dig a whole hide you there And you disappear forever Wow that sounds fun mum can i join the game? Stop! Why? Its no game, its painful game of loss! Mum, you cry when i climb trees When dad wants to go with me you scream But dad always makes cool choices You don't understand son, Your father has played the superman game The monster broke his neck And now he is lifeless like your toys All the people that came here were on your Dad's funeral Your father is dead You are now an orphan, son! Mum, dad is in the game I know dad he will rise again Kick the monster, break its neck and throw it in fire Like what he used to about Jesus And you will know he is not like my toys I know son Right now you cant understand but later you will I know mum Right now you cant understand but later you will In memory of my late father who passed on in 1993 while i was a little boy
